Panthers Fall to Cowboys as Bryce Young Struggles with Turnovers and Pressure
Carolina's offensive line falters, leading to a season-high six sacks and four turnovers for the second-year quarterback in a 30-14 loss.
- Bryce Young committed a career-high four turnovers, including two interceptions and two fumbles, as the Panthers' offense sputtered against Dallas.
- The Cowboys' defense overwhelmed Carolina's offensive line, sacking Young six times and forcing critical mistakes in key moments.
- Carolina's league-worst run defense gave up 211 rushing yards, marking the fifth time in six games they have allowed over 190 yards on the ground.
- Undrafted rookie Jalen Coker provided a rare bright spot with an 83-yard touchdown reception and a career-high 110 receiving yards in the loss.
- The Panthers, now 3-11, have missed the playoffs for seven consecutive seasons and will face the Arizona Cardinals in their home finale next week.
